Or...if you aren't happy with the service you have received thus far, you are more than in your right to send a letter to cancel your order, demanding your credit card be issued a credit or a check to be sent to you within a reasonable number of days. If you receive a negative response you then can file a dispute with your credit card company. Personally, I'd send the letter certified mail requiring a signature...makes it hard for the person to say they didn't receive notice.
Simply inform them of your dissatisfaction with the timeframe thus far and their lack of communication as to the reasons for your cancellation.
Take that money and spend it on one of the many companies and/or individuals that can build you a CP AND provide good customer service.
